Andries Kruger is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science and Environmental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Andries Kruger has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 2.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 9 papers in Atmospheric Science and 4 papers in Environmental Engineering. Recurrent topics in Andries Kruger’s work include Climate variability and models (22 papers), Global Drought Monitoring and Assessment (12 papers) and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(9 papers). Andries Kruger is often cited by papers focused on Climate variability and models (22 papers), Global Drought Monitoring and Assessment (12 papers) and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(9 papers). Andries Kruger collaborates with scholars based in South Africa, United States and Germany. Andries Kruger's co-authors include Dmitri Bessarabov, C. Mcbride, J.V. Retief, Liesl L. Dyson and Steven Shongwe and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, PLoS ONE and Journal of Hydrology.
